For sale is a lovely set of four Galvanitas S16 Compass Chairs, arguably the most iconic school chair ever produced. The first to design with sheet metal was obviously Jean Prouve, but in The Netherlands the experiments with these classic compass leg subframes really exploded in the 1950s. Friso Kramer and Wim Rietveld designed the similar looking Result Chair for Ahrend in the same period, but the S16 turned out to be the most successful —featuring in most schools and canteens of office- and government buildings.
